Choosing the Right Pumpkin Carving Kit
Blade Material & Sharpness
The most important factor in a pumpkin carving kit is the quality of the blades. Stainless steel is the standard, but the thickness and quality of the steel vary greatly. Thicker, high-quality stainless steel (like 304 stainless steel) will hold an edge longer and are less likely to bend when encountering tough pumpkin rinds. Sharper blades mean cleaner cuts, reducing the effort needed and creating more detailed designs. Dull blades require more force, increasing the risk of slipping and injury. Consider kits specifically mentioning “ultra-sharp” or “high-carbon” steel for optimal performance.
Handle Design & Ergonomics
Carving pumpkins can take time, and a poorly designed handle can lead to hand fatigue and discomfort. Look for kits with ergonomic handles – those molded to fit comfortably in your hand. Features like anti-slip grips are crucial, especially when working with wet or slippery pumpkin flesh. Larger handles generally offer more control and leverage, making it easier to apply pressure and create precise cuts. Some kits feature removable handles on scoops for versatility.
Kit Contents & Versatility
Pumpkin carving kits range from basic sets with just a few tools to comprehensive kits with dozens. Consider what kind of carving you plan to do. A basic kit with a saw, scoop, and a few etching tools is sufficient for simple designs. However, if you’re interested in intricate details or 3D carving, a larger kit with a wider range of saws, drills, and sculpting tools will be necessary. Kits including stencils can be a great starting point for beginners or those seeking inspiration. Mold-based kits can provide a simpler carving experience, especially for younger children.
Safety Features
Safety should be a top priority, particularly when carving with children. Look for kits with features like rounded blade tips, protective sleeves, or handles designed to prevent cuts. Thick, sturdy handles are also safer than flimsy plastic ones. Always supervise children closely when they are using carving tools.
Additional Features
- Scoops: A sturdy scoop is essential for removing pumpkin seeds and pulp efficiently.
- Drills/Pokes: Useful for creating patterns, ventilation holes, or adding small details.
- Etching Tools: Great for surface-level designs and fine lines.
- Storage: A carrying case or box keeps the tools organized and protected.
- Stencils: Helpful for beginners or those wanting specific designs.
